Precautions For Basket-type Dishwashers
Mar 14, 2025| The following precautions should be taken when installing and using a frame-type dishwasher:
Size reservation: When installing a dishwasher, it is recommended to follow the size reservation diagram provided by the official website and reserve some extra space to ensure that the dishwasher can be installed and used smoothly. Too precise dimensions may cause installation difficulties and make modifications more troublesome.
Water and electricity layout: The water inlet and drainage pipes should be reserved in the cabinet next to the dishwasher, not directly behind it, so as to avoid the dishwasher protruding from the cabinet and affecting the appearance and safety. Power sockets should also be reserved in the cabinets on both sides to avoid the sockets being blocked by the dishwasher.
Cabinet design: If the dishwasher is placed in a corner, do not install a pull-out basket on the cabinet at the 90-degree corner to avoid affecting the opening and closing of the dishwasher. In addition, the opening diameter of the cabinet should be 5cm to ensure that the power supply, water inlet and drainage interfaces can be smoothly connected.
Installation order: In the early stage of kitchen decoration, you should communicate with the cabinet and water and electricity masters to determine the water and electricity location and cabinet design to avoid inconvenience caused by later changes.
Precautions for use:
The dishwasher must have a grounding wire, and the various switches and buttons on the control panel cannot be wetted by water.
The dishwasher should be placed horizontally on a flat ground, away from gas stoves and corrosive gases, and close to faucets and drains.
The tableware should be placed correctly according to the instructions for use. The wrong placement will affect the cleaning effect.
Use special dishwasher detergent, and do not use other detergents instead.
The washed tableware should not contain other debris, such as fish bones, leftovers, etc., so as not to clog the filter or hinder the rotation of the nozzle.
After washing, clean the filter residue and keep the inner cavity of the dishwasher clean to prevent odor.
